President Museveni appoints a committee to overlook the NRM local council elections, Tanga Odoi sent to Ankole

September 10, 2020

Ruling National Resistance Movement (NRM) chairman President Yoweri Museveni has appointed a team that will oversee the local council elections.

The 23 member team will be working in different parts of the country,to ensure a free and fair electoral process.

The team comprises of the party Secretary General, Justine Kasule Lumumba, treasurer, Rose Namayanja Nsereko, John Arimpa Kigyagi and Charles Egou, who will be in charge of central region.

Other appointed members include Dr. Tanga Odoi(Ankole region), Mike Ssebalu and Jane Babiiha Alisemera(Kampala and Wakiso),Mathias Kasamba(Greater Masaka), Anthony Iga(Greater Mubende and Mpigi) while Juliet Kabonesa will be in charge of greater Mukono region.

Other party officials appointed include Senior Presidential Advisor on Diaspora affairs, Hajji Abbey Walusimbi who will be in charge of greater Luweero region while Col.Shaban Bantariza(Busoga region), Emmanuel Dombo(Teso region) and Richard Todwong (Acholi region).

According to the NRM Director for information and publicity, Emmanuel Dombo, who is also part of the team, said that he would get full details of team's work before the polling exercise.

NRM party held their Parliamentary primary elections on September 04, where they lined up behind candidates, for their first time as adopted by the party's committee early this year, but the exercise was characterized chaos and violence.

While responding to the recently concluded voting exercise last week, President Museveni said the game is finished for party members who were involved in creating the violence.

"There was violence in a constituency called Bukono where 12 people were beaten and cut with pangas. I got information that police had not done much work. I told IGP that if police didn't do the work, I will do it for them by arresting them first and then bring the rest myself. I have the capacity to do it," said Museveni.

Among the regions that experienced a lot of violence were Nkore (Ankole), Sembabule and Namutumba regions. The team members will be expected to ensure that peace, and harmony prevail during the local council elections.
